SOCNORTH CBT VEHICLES TO SUPPORT TRAINING AT CAMP SHELBY AND EGLIN AFB. is a federal award for Socnorth Pb held by Red Orange North America Inc. Estimated value $1M ($976K obligated). Current period of performance ends Jul 10, 2026. Last award drew 7 bidders. Place of performance: HATTIESBURG MS.
SOCNORTH CBT VEHICLES TO SUPPORT TRAINING AT CAMP SHELBY AND EGLIN AFB.
